B-type natriuretic peptide is a major predictor of ventricular tachyarrhythmias

Abstract

Background The cost-effective use of implantable cardioverter- defibrillators (ICDs) for the prevention of sudden cardiac death requires identification of patients at risk for ventricular tachyarrhythmias, not just for total mortality. Objective To determine whether N-terminal pro-B-type natriuretic peptide (NT-proBNP) or B-type natriuretic peptide (BNP) are independent predictors of ventricular arrhythmias in patients receiving primary prevention ICDs. Methods One hundred sixty-one patients with NT-proBNP levels and 403 patients with BNP levels at the time of ICD implantation were retrospectively assessed for the occurrence of first appropriate ICD therapy and mortality.
